Abstract

Abstract

En 中文
The compactness of antenna arrays is highly restricted due to the mutual coupling effect between radiation elements, which degrades the arrays' performances with respect to impedance matching, radiation efficiency, and antenna diversity. A two-port compact printed monopole antenna array with a novel and simple decoupling structure based on partially extended ground plane applicable for small terminals is presented. The distance between the printed monopole elements is less than 0.25 lambda. A broad matching and decoupling bandwidth up to 1.5 GHz (5.1-6.6 GHz) is achieved. The approach is proven by both simulations and measurements.
